Rubidium Cesium and Compounds Market Size

The global Rubidium Cesium and Compounds market was valued at US$ 346 million in 2025 and is anticipated to reach US$ 1250 million by 2032, at a CAGR of 20.4% from 2026 to 2032.

Cesium element symbol Cs, atomic number 55, density 1.88g/cm ³, melting point 28.4 ℃, boiling point 678.4 ℃. Cesium metal has a light golden yellow color, is very soft, and has ductility. Cesium has extremely active chemical properties, and its compounds mainly include cesium carbonate, cesium formate, cesium bromide, cesium chloride, cesium fluoride, cesium iodide, cesium hydroxide, cesium nitrate, cesium oxide, cesium sulfate, cesium alum, etc. In terms of downstream applications, as a rare mineral, cesium metal and cesium salts are irreplaceable in many industries. Currently, their main application areas include atomic clocks, energy, chemical engineering, medical fields, etc.
Rubidium element symbol Rb, atomic number 37, density 1.53g/cm3, melting point 38.89 ℃, boiling point 688 ℃. Metal rubidium is silver white wax like, soft and light in texture, and has ductility. The compounds of rubidium used in industry mainly include rubidium oxide (Rb2O, RbO2, Rb2O2, etc.), rubidium hydroxide, rubidium carbonate, rubidium sulfate, rubidium nitrate, etc. Due to their similar physical properties and atomic radii, rubidium and cesium have similar downstream applications and can be used interchangeably in many applications. However, due to the stronger positive charge of cesium compared to rubidium, and the fact that rubidium does not have independent mineral deposits and is usually a byproduct of lithium and cesium production, it is not easier to obtain than cesium, making cesium more widely used than rubidium.

With the rapid development of science and technology, rubidium, cesium, and their compounds, with their excellent physical, chemical, and optoelectronic properties, are not only used in traditional catalysts and cesium atomic clocks, but also play an irreplaceable role in high-tech fields such as perovskite cells, magnetohydrodynamic power generation, and ion propellants. However, rubidium and cesium are rare independent minerals in nature and mainly exist in lithium containing ores such as potassium feldspar, muscovite, lithium mica, and cesium garnet. Currently, the main source of industrial rubidium and cesium is still tailings from lithium extraction. The rubidium cesium ore resources in China are very limited, and most of them exist in salt lake brine. The average concentration of rubidium and cesium in salt lakes is very low, and they coexist with a large number of alkali metal ions such as Li+, Na+, K+, etc. This is the biggest difficulty in extracting rubidium and cesium from salt lake brine. With the continuous expansion of demand for rubidium and its compounds, their separation and purification technologies have been continuously developed. From the earliest hierarchical crystallization separation method and precipitation method, to the current ion exchange method, solvent extraction method, etc., the product quality of rubidium and its compounds has been continuously improved, and the production cost has been gradually reduced. The unique characteristics of rubidium and its compounds, such as high stability of radiation frequency, easy ionization, excellent optoelectronic properties, and strong chemical activity, have shown broad application prospects and market demand in high-tech fields such as defense industry, aerospace industry, biotechnology, medicine, and energy industry, especially in the field of energy, which has great potential and imagination. At present, it has been applied in electronic devices (photomultiplier tubes, phototubes), spectrophotometers, automatic control, spectral measurement, color movies and televisions, radar, lasers, ion rockets, thermal ion energy converters, glass, ceramics, electronic clocks, atomic clocks, and many other fields.
